In the second of five programmes, Johnnie Walker looks at favourite classic albums. This week it's Elton John's 'Goodbye Yellow Brick Road' from 1973.

Elton's seventh studio album was produced by Gus Dudgeon at the Honky Chateau in France, with some preparation and recording in Kingston, Jamaica.

It features the famous Marilyn Monroe tribute, 'Candle in the Wind', as well as three successful singles: 'Bennie and the Jets', 'Goodbye Yellow Brick Road', and 'Saturday Night's Alright for Fighting' alongside cult favourites like 'Funeral For A Friend/Love Lies Bleeding'.

The programme will feature highlights from the double album with comment and cultural history from Johnnie and broadcaster and critic David Hepworth alongside archive interviews with many of the key players.
